About the role: Reports to the Financial Reporting Manager This highly numerical position will be working with an established team in our US office, who service Private Equity, Real Estate, Infrastructure, and Private Credit products for both mid-market and institutional clients. This is an exciting opportunity for a motivated candidate to make a significant impact to our growing US business and to work with a growing and dynamic team.

Requirements

  • 3+ years relevant experience in Fund Accounting or Audit, ideally in the alternative funds sector (either in-house with a fund manager or a fund administrator)
  • Experience with capital calls, distributions, investor capital activity and financial statements preparation
  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Economics or equivalent relevant experience is essential
  • Sound technical knowledge of US GAAP and reporting required for the alternative funds sectors
  • Good interpersonal skills are required to develop close working relationships with colleagues, clients and business contacts
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ced entrepreneurial environment with a curious attitude and desire to learn
  • Excellent collaboration skills and passionate team player

Nice To Haves

  • Private Equity specific experience is preferred
  • CPA accreditation is advantageous

Responsibilities

  • Recording of all activity for a portfolio of Private Funds and SPVs, including responding to ad-hoc investor and client requests.
  • Preparation of financial statements, investor capital statements, capital call and distribution notices in accordance with US GAAP (and at times IFRS and UK/Lux GAAP).
  • Researching accounting guidance as necessary to ensure correct recording of complex transactions.
  • Liaising with client auditors and tax preparers, responding to requests for information.
  • Preparation of investor reporting including calculations of investor and fund performance.
  • Participating in projects that focus on improving efficiencies or enhancing internal controls.
  • Assisting with the training and mentoring of junior members of staff.
